Summit County: Iconic Recreation and Historic Charm

Summit County is home to some of Colorado’s most renowned ski resorts, including Breckenridge, Keystone, and Copper Mountain. While winter sports dominate the colder months, residents and visitors enjoy a wealth of year-round activities such as hiking, mountain biking, fishing, and boating on the scenic Lake Dillon. Breckenridge, with its historic Main Street lined with Victorian homes, boutique shops, and restaurants, offers both charm and convenience. Silverthorne and Frisco provide a mix of modern and rustic homes with stunning views of the surrounding peaks and valleys. Real estate options in Summit County range from cozy ski condos and townhomes to expansive estates, many offering ski-in/ski-out access and proximity to trails.

Eagle County: Luxury in Vail and Beaver Creek

Just 30 miles west of Summit County, Eagle County is synonymous with luxury mountain living. Vail and Avon are global destinations, known for their world-class ski resorts and picturesque villages. Vail Village, with its European-inspired architecture, upscale dining, and boutique shopping, is a hub of activity year-round. Avon’s Beaver Creek provides a more secluded and family-friendly environment, with elegant ski-in/ski-out homes and chalets. Eagle County real estate features opulent condos, sprawling estates, and chalets with breathtaking mountain views and high-end finishes.

Grand County: Adventure in Winter Park, Grand Lake, and Granby

Grand County offers a more laid-back mountain lifestyle, with its towns of Winter Park, Grand Lake, and Granby attracting residents seeking tranquility and adventure. Winter Park features a top-tier ski resort and a vibrant real estate market, including condos, townhomes, and single-family homes that cater to outdoor enthusiasts. Grand Lake, located at the entrance to Rocky Mountain National Park, is known for its stunning waterfront properties, cozy cabins, and picturesque mountain estates. Residents enjoy fishing, kayaking, and boating on the largest natural lake in Colorado. Granby offers a peaceful retreat with expansive ranches, mountain homes, and access to the family-friendly Granby Ranch ski resort.
